Investors scared of risks in frontier basins – NAPE

The President of the Nigerian Association of Petroleum Explorationists, Johnbosco Uche, says investors are not ready to take risks in Nigeria’s frontier basins as they are not sure of hydrocarbon reserves. Frontier basins are geological areas where hydrocarbon exploration activities have not been conducted or where commercial oil and gas discoveries haven’t been made. The...
